LA GENERACIÓN ANSIOSA
by by Jonathan Haidt
Un coautor de "The Coddling of the American Mind" analiza las repercusiones que tiene en la salud mental de los niños una vida basada en el teléfono.

CUDI
by by Scott "Kid Cudi" Mescudi
The Grammy Award–winning artist describes obstacles he encountered during his career.

SEMI-WELL-ADJUSTED DESPITE LITERALLY EVERYTHING
by by Alyson Stoner
The actor and dancer recounts childhood fame, past traumas and the search for stability.

ON POWER
by by Mark R. Levin
The Fox News host considers various facets of power and its effect on history.

THE FORT BRAGG CARTEL
by by Seth Harp
An Iraq war veteran and investigative reporter delves into unsolved murders connected to drug trafficking at the Special Operations base.

THE IDAHO FOUR
by by James Patterson and Vicky Ward
Investigations into the murders of four University of Idaho students on Nov. 13, 2022.

TODO ES TUBERCULOSIS
by by John Green
El autor de "El antropoceno revisado" relata la lucha contra la mortal enfermedad infecciosa de la tuberculosis.

BLACK AF HISTORY
by by Michael Harriot
A columnist at TheGrio.com articulates moments in American history that center the perspectives and experiences of Black Americans.

OUTLIVE
by by Peter Attia with Bill Gifford
Una mirada a la investigación científica reciente sobre el envejecimiento y la longevidad.

ABUNDANCIA
by by Ezra Klein and Derek Thompson
Un columnista de opinión del New York Times y un redactor de The Atlantic evalúan los obstáculos al progreso estadounidense.

TONIGHT IN JUNGLELAND
by by Peter Ames Carlin
The author of “Bruce” portrays the making of Springsteen’s album “Born to Run.”

THE UNDISCOVERED COUNTRY
by by Paul Andrew Hutton
A narrative history of the American West featuring stories about Daniel Boone, Red Eagle, Davy Crockett, Mangas Coloradas, Kit Carson, Sitting Bull and William “Buffalo Bill” Cody.

ONE NATION ALWAYS UNDER GOD
by by Tim Scott
The Republican senator from South Carolina depicts the influence Christianity had on some prominent people and institutions.

WHEN BREATH BECOMES AIR
by by Paul Kalanithi
A memoir by a physician who received a diagnosis of Stage IV lung cancer at the age of 36.

COMING UP SHORT
by by Robert B. Reich
An economist who served in three presidential administrations gives his perspective on his generation’s impact on democracy, society and the economy.
